incorruptible in Russian is неподку́пный — incorruptible means impossible to bribe or morally corrupt.
incorruptible in Russian
неподку́пный
Pronounced: nepodkupnyy
Incapable of being bribed or morally corrupted; inflexibly just and upright.
What does "incorruptible" mean?
-
adj Impossible to bribe or morally corrupt.
"The judge had a reputation for being incorruptible."
-
adj Not subject to decay or physical corruption.
"The old scrolls were kept in an incorruptible case to preserve them."
